made to order

made to order  {adj. phr.}
1. Made specially in the way the buyer wants instead of all the same in large amounts; made especially for the buyer.
Mr. Black's clothes were all made to order.
Compare: MADE-TO-MEASURE.
2. Just right.
The weather was made to order for the hike.
